ex4_20.m
来自「华东理工大学自动化系《控制系统分析、设计和应用》教材配套程序实例,有关说明: 」· M 代码 · 共 31 行
M
31 行
% ex4_20
% 已知多变量系统的传递函数矩阵,绘制格希哥仁圆和格希哥仁带
clear;num={[1],[0.75];[0.75],[1]};
den={[1 1],[2 1];[2 1],[0.5 1]};
G=tf(num,den);
b=10;
for i=1:2;
for k=1:2
w=[0,logspace(-1,0.2,b)];
gg(i,k,:)=polyval(deconv(den{i,k},num{i,k}),j*w);
end;
end;
figure('pos',[100,100,400,210],'color','w');
g(1,:)=gg(1,1,:);
r(1,:)=abs(gg(1,2,:));
g(2,:)=gg(2,2,:);
r(2,:)=abs(gg(2,1,:));
for l=1:2
axes('pos',[0.05+0.5*(l-1) 0.2 0.4 0.7]);
for n=1:b+1
t=0:.01:2*pi;
x(n,:)=r(l,n).*cos(t)+real(g(l,n));
y(n,:)=r(l,n).*sin(t)+imag(g(l,n));
plot(x(n,:),y(n,:));
hold on;
end;
grid;
plot(g(l,:));
end;
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?